Abstract
An ultrasound imaging and biopsy system is provided in which an upper compression member of the system includes a thin, flexible, sterile and disposable membrane that compresses the tissue and permits a biopsy instrument to be readily inserted therethrough. In a preferred embodiment, a table is provided that houses an ultrasound scanning system beneath a sonolucent window forming a lower compression surface. Methods of using the system to perform real-time image-guided biopsy of tissue disposed on the window are also provided.

17. A method for securing biological tissue to a compression surface for ultrasound imaging and biopsy, the method comprising steps of:
-
providing apparatus including an ultrasonic imaging table having a compression surface, a thin, flexible, presterilized membrane that is conformable and performable, and locking mechanism for engaging the membrane to the compression surface; disposing tissue on the compression surface; placing the membrane over the tissue; engaging the locking mechanism to pull the membrane taut to compress and immobilize the tissue between the membrane and the compression surface; and activating the ultrasonic imaging table to generate and display an ultrasound image of the tissue. - View Dependent Claims (18, 19, 20)
